I have a fluorescent light fixture over my kitchen sink that will now only illuminate at the dimly at the ends. Assuming the bulb is good (brand new), what could be the cause? I'm using a GE Reveal reveal F20T12I 20 watt bulp. I removed the cover over the ballast, and here is what it looks like: http://ift.tt/2xSh0gQ, it's very old. Do I need to replace the ballast (would I even be able to find a comparable one)? Also, stupid question but does "trigger start" mean there is no starter? I've also read this issue could be the "starter". via /r/DIY http://ift.tt/2xVPaRS
